Deciphering the Odds: What is RTP, Exactly?

Before we draw further parallels to the beautiful game, let’s get technical. What exactly is the Return to Player (RTP) rate, a term frequently seen when reviewing any Pinco slot or browsing through Pinco casino? Simply put, RTP is the theoretical percentage of all wagered money that a slot machine or casino game will pay back to players over time. If a slot has an RTP of 96%, it means that, statistically and over millions of spins, the machine will return $0.96 for every $1 bet. This crucial number determines the “fairness” and statistical probability of the game. It’s the closest thing to a guaranteed return you can get.  The Long Game: Why You Can’t Judge RTP in a Single Spin

This is where the analogy with the 90th-minute goal truly shines. Just as you cannot predict a football team’s performance based on the first ten minutes of a match, you cannot judge a slot’s 96% RTP on a single session. RTP is a long-term average. You might lose five sessions in a row, only to hit a massive win that mathematically brings the rate back up. The football fan’s belief system operates on a similar principle: years of disappointment (low returns) are instantly validated by one historic, dramatic goal (a massive payout).
